What certificates do I need to obtain to engage in futures financing?
To engage in futures financing, you need to obtain certificates such as futures qualification certificate, gold investment analyst certificate, foreign exchange analyst certificate, securities qualification certificate, financial planner certificate, banking qualification certificate and insurance qualification certificate.

When handling these certificates, you can register on the official website of the local human resources and social security bureau.

If you are a financial planner, you need to find a financial planner. However, the application conditions for financial planners are relatively strict at present. To apply for the lowest-level assistant financial planner (national vocational qualification level 3), you need to meet one of the following conditions, and you need two certificates of relevant working years issued by the unit (both of which need to be stamped with the personnel seal of the unit).

(1) has been engaged in his own work for more than 6 years.

② College degree or above in finance related major. Related majors refer to economics, management and law.

(3) graduated from non-financial related majors and engaged in financial related work for more than one year.
